VAT increment begins February 1 – Finance Minister.
Zainab Ahmed, the minister of finance, budget and national planning, says the implementation of the new value-added tax rate will begin on February 1, 2o2o. The minister announced this at the ongoing inauguration of the Federal Inland Revenue Service board. This comes days after the bill was signed by President Muhammadu Buhari which includes a 7% increase on value added tax.

US Senate to commence Donald Trump’s Impeachment Trial
The House on Wednesday had delivered articles of impeachment against President Donald Trump. A signing ceremony was held on Wednesday by Speaker Nancy Pelosi, along party lines, to send the articles to the other side of the Capitol and appoint the Democrats’ handpicked team of impeachment managers. Senate Majority leader Mitch McConnell after receiving the articles of impeachment revealed that the impeachment trial will commence on Tuesday.

Barcelona named Richest Club in the World
According to deloitte, one of the largest accounting agencies in the world, Barcelona is the richest club in the world in 2020 for the first time. It broke the €800 million mark after reportedly recording astronomical revenues of €840.8 million. Manchester United despite poor displays on the field, remains the most valuable club in England.

Nigerian Defender, Camron Gbadegbo Moves to Manchester City
It gas been reported that Premier League Champions, Manchester City have signed Nigerian defender Camron Gbadebo from Premier League rivals Leicester City following a successful trial. The 17-year-old is bidding farewell to the Foxes after nine appearances for their U18 team in the U18 Premier League. The defender will join Flying Eagles invitee Fisayo Dele-Bashiru, Felix Nmecha, Nathanael Ogbeta, Gavin Bazunu, Samuel Edozie and Timi Sobowale.

Hope Uzodinma sworn-in as Imo Governor
Few hours after receiving the Certificate of Return from the Independent National electoral Commission, Senator Hope Uzodinma, has been sworn in as the Governor of Imo State. Uzodinma was sworn in by the Chief Judge of the state, Paschal Nnadi, on Wednesday evening.
